What is ADHD?
ADHD is characterized by signs that consist of inattention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. These signs often manifest in a different way amongst people, leading to a diverse variety of presentations. The disorder can affect various aspects of life, making complex relationships, work, and academic accomplishments.

A private ADHD assessment generally follows a structured process. Here's a breakdown of what one can anticipate:
1. Initial Consultation:An initial consultation with a certified healthcare professional permits them to understand the person's background and concerns. This may include a detailed history of providing symptoms.2. Standardized Testing:Various standardized tests may be administered to examine ADHD signs and their effect on daily performance. These could include questionnaires for the specific and possibly for member of the family or educators.3. Observations:The expert may observe habits in different settings, such as home and school, to understand the person's working much better.4. Case History Review:A comprehensive medical history is frequently significant to rule out co-existing conditions, such as learning disorders or stress and anxiety.5. Feedback Session:Once the assessment is complete, the assessor will offer feedback, typically summarizing findings and discussing recommendations for treatment or further assistance.6. Treatment Plan:If detected with ADHD, a tailored treatment plan will be discussed, which may include behavior modification, medication, or recommendations to professionals.What to Consider Before the Assessment
